你不能用beep吗?或者我们说你可以调用c,比如:public partial class Form1 : Form{ private DevicesCollection myDevices = null; private struct myDeviceDescription { public DeviceInformation info; public override string ToString() { return info.Description; } public myDeviceDescription(DeviceInformation di) { info = di; } } public Form1() { InitializeComponent(); } private void Form1_Load(object sender, EventArgs e) { } private void button1_Click(object sender, EventArgs e) { myDevices = new DevicesCollection(); Guid driverGuid = Guid.Empty; foreach (DeviceInformation deviceInfo in myDevices) { if (!string.IsNullOrEmpty(deviceInfo.ModuleName)) { driverGuid = deviceInfo.DriverGuid; break; } } Device dv = new Device(driverGuid); dv.SetCooperativeLevel(this, CooperativeLevel.Normal); SecondaryBuffer buf = new SecondaryBuffer("nopayhint.wav", dv); buf.Play(0, BufferPlayFlags.Default); }}
为王益等地区用户提供了全套网页设计制作服务,及王益网站建设行业解决方案。主营业务为成都网站设计、做网站、王益网站设计,以传统方式定制建设网站,并提供域名空间备案等一条龙服务,秉承以专业、用心的态度为用户提供真诚的服务。我们深信只要达到每一位用户的要求,就会得到认可,从而选择与我们长期合作。这样,我们也可以走得更远!
这段代码当然要你自己写接口,高手同事写的,我也看的不是很懂
或者是喇叭:
#include dos.h
int main(void)
{
sound(频率); delay(时间); nosound(); return 0;
}
要你自己写接口代码,不过我感觉还是直接点:
用Beep(频率,时间);
然后时间是以毫秒为单位
我记得是频率200是一个比较好听的提示音,当然每个人喜好不同按照你喜欢的来
我不知道合不合乎你的要求,我做程序一般用这个,毕竟从开始学就用也改不了了
工作上也能看。。。。。。
如果和你要求符合的话就给个采纳
如果不符合也别说我,谢谢。
另外如有雷同纯属巧合,谢谢。
VS2013
建议装个虚拟机XP系统 然后完美运行VC6++(最好的学C软件)
安装具体步骤:
1,安装前,请确定下载文件的大写及文件名称;
2,先安装《通用环境》。——进入文件夹“EnvMEL”,点击“SETUP” 进行安装;
3,完成设置以后,点击《后退》按钮,返回到原来的文件夹“GX Developer”,点击“SETUP” ,出现软件系列号并且开始安装“安装向导” ;
4,注意安装的提示,在安装的时候,最好把其他应用程序关掉,包括杀毒软件,防火墙,IE,办公软件。 因为这些软件可能会调用系统的其他文件,影响安装的正常进行。 接着点“确定”出现“用户信息” 点“下一个” 出现“注册确认”对话框;
5,输入各种注册信息后,选择“是”,然后出现“输入序列号”对话框, 注意,不同软件的序列号可能会不相同,序列号可以在下载后的压缩包里得到。 点击:“下一个”;
6,千万注意“监视专用”这里不能打勾(安装选项中,每一个步骤要仔细看,有的选项打勾了反而不利)一直点“下一个”这两个地方可以勾,“选择安装目标位置”。 一直点“下一个”,就开始安装。
7,等待安装5-10分钟后,安装完成,系统弹出此窗口,点击“确定”。